Finding Gold in Colorado: Prospector's Edition: A guide to Colorado's casual gold prospecting, mining history and sightseeing Kindle Edition

4.8 out of 5 stars 384 ratings

Updated for 2025! Travel guidebook inspired by the gold prospecting origin of Colorado. Includes touring information on all the major towns founded as gold mining camps as well as summaries of each town's origin story. Includes reviews and recommendations on historic districts to visit, mines to tour, driving tours of ghost towns and places to gold pan. Includes information on 16 historic districts, 31 museums, 18 mines, 186 gold panning sites across the state of Colorado. Thoroughly researched to confirm public access to the panning sites (no private property or areas subject to mining claim has been included - unlike other books.) Written by a long-time Colorado resident and gold prospector. Based on years of research and field work. Get your share of the gold by prospecting for it in historic, urban, and remote locations across the gold districts of Colorado. From the Author

This book started as an MS Word document with all the details of goldpanning sites I could find or learn from others. I gathered it all so Icould go gold panning when my wife and i went on photo safaris into theColorado mountains - she is a trained landscape photographer. As my Word doc grew, it became both more challenging to organize and moreinspiring to me.

My friend Don urged me toconsider writing a book and, with my wife's encouragement, I took up thechallenge. After several years of additional detailed research and field trips to every relevant part of Colorado, I had what I needed to make a real book.

Of course writing a book is its ownchallenge. I thought I was writing a 200 page book with a few dozen digsites; what I ended up with is a LOT more than that! At almost 500pages, and with almost 200 public dig sites, this book took my life over completely while I did the actual writing. I also included campingoptions in each area and lots of local history. With all this greatinformation, I am confident it will completely change your experience of exploring Colorado gold country with your gold pan in hand. "Find YOURGold!"

    Kevin has done an excellent job in establishing a modern gold prospecting culture in Colorado through this book. Over the years the extraction industries have earned a reputation for plunder and leave. Kevin does an excellent job separating recreational gold seekers from these industries. He shows the way that those involved in this hobby can leave the stream and banks better than they found them, thus insuring access for their grandchildren and others.
